About the Role:
The Sales Enablement Content Developer is responsible for working alongside key stakeholders to develop and deliver effective content for the sales organization. This role will consist of working with sales, marketing, product, and other business units to provide a consistent experience for our sellers and ensure we're delivering necessary proactive training, coupled with critical just-in-time sales resources.
What You'll Do:

  • Partner with Field Enablement and all go to market teams to develop and design content in support of our GTM movements.
  • Build and influence content strategy across multiple pillars of the business and GTM teams.
  • Design and create professional, engaging, and informative enablement presentations, collateral, scripts, supporting assets and one-sheeters, standardized and tailored for sellers by role.
  • Utilize creative skills to design visually appealing presentations, infographics, newsletters, and other sales enablement materials while maintaining brand consistency.
  • Incorporate multimedia elements such as videos, animations, and graphics to increase engagement and learning retention, while enhancing the learning experience.
  • Build and edit video presentations and online learning while maintaining brand governance and standards.
  • Evaluate and update existing content to reflect current brand standards and improve effectiveness.
  • Measure, track, and report effectiveness of content and evolve as needed in collaboration with Content Lead.
  • Partner with leadership to tailor and update existing content for various sales roles and segments.
  • Manage and organize content within the LMS/CMS to ensure materials are up to date.


What You'll Need:

  • 2+ years SaaS sales experience
  • 3+ years in Content Design
  • Understanding of sales process, customer lifecycles, and various qualification (MEDDPICC) and sales methodologies (Force Management, Sandler, etc.)
  • Experience in direct sales or enablement content creation for cybersecurity companies
  • Proven experience in content design and creation (presentations, internal supporting assets, training plans, etc.) in a sales enablement or training role.
  • Experience with instructional design and an ability to design content for multiple purposes and a variety of modalities (in-person, virtual, on-line coursework/asynchronous learning, etc.).
  • Full understanding of content strategy and operations, visual communications.
  • Proficiency in graphic design tools and presentation software (Google Slides, PowerPoint, etc.) video editing (Camtasia).
  • Experience with L&D and content management software (Litmos, Highspot, Articulate Rise 360, Seismic, Allego, etc.) and manage content lifecycle through tooling.
  • A willingness to stay up to date with emerging technologies in the L&D and Content management space.
  • Ability to think strategically and align content creation efforts with broader enablement goals and organizational objectives i.e. understanding the sales process, buyer journey, target audience, and content delivery tools.
  • Ability to collaborate and influence cross functional teams and business units, including but not limited to Field Enablement, Marketing, Product Marketing, Sales Engineering and Sales Leaders.
  • Program and project management skills, an ability to work independently and manage multiple projects independently while maintaining target dates and deliverables.
  • Highly organized, accurate, detail oriented, and proactive.
  • Ability to synchronize and templatize effective trainings and content for scale and efficiency.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ills to convey complex concepts, craft persuasive messaging and copy.
  • Ability to leverage available tooling to measure effectiveness and impact of content, and adapt accordingly.
